// REINDEX_BATCH_CAP limits docs per shard pass in the Tallowfield
// nightly search reindex. Raising it starves the ingest queue;
// lowering it overruns the maintenance window. 5000 is the tested
// sweet spot. Change only with a soak run. Verified against the
// build noted below.

session token of bawif-hahog = htk6_ac5981

AI-7 from the Trailnote outage review: offline mode kept hammering sync even with no connectivity, which drained batteries and flooded the queue when signal returned. Fix is a proper backoff with a capped queue and a staleness cutoff so ancient drafts don't stampede the API. On-call: if sync storms recur, these knobs are the first thing to tweak. Current values are set by the constants below.

tuning table, kajog-kawef:
PRIORITIES = {
    "kelox": 870,
    "kasix": 89,
    "eliax": 988,
}

**Ticket QV-2187: Kotlin SDK missing batch upload from Swift SDK**

Hey support folks — customers on Flintbeam's Kotlin SDK keep asking why batch uploads work on iOS but not Android. It's not a bug, just parity lag; fix lands next sprint. Until then, point them to the single-upload workaround doc. The parity fix is in the build referenced below.

session token of tajog-fahaf = htk21_4ae55819f45410afcb307

# Build Provenance — Plottica Autocomplete Widget

All widget bundles ship from the Harkwell pipeline. No manual uploads, ever. Each release is built from a tagged commit, signed, and mirrored to the Ferndale CDN. If a customer reports a stale suggestion list, verify the bundle hash before touching config. Rebuilds require approval from the Plottica release channel. For reference, the current production artifact carries the trace token shown below.

build token for tahop-fafof: htk14_2d55df8101eccc

## Changelog — Splitwick Assignment Service v2.9.0

Changed defaults: new experiments now use deterministic bucketing by subject hash instead of session-scoped random assignment. Sticky reassignment on variant retirement is enabled by default. Existing experiments are unaffected until re-saved. Reviewers should confirm the hashing salt rotation window matches rollout expectations. The defaults now shipped with the service are as follows.

config for kawif-hahig:
zorix:
  log_level: error
  metrics_host: metrics.zorix.lumiclabs.internal
  pool_size: 16